The Royal Cayman Islands Police Service has officially charged an 18-year-old North Side man, who was arrested on 12 April, with assault with grievous bodily harm.

In the press release, issued 15 April, police said the man was slated to appear in court Monday in relation to the incident that took place on 16 March on Market Street in Camana Bay, when a man was reportedly assaulted with a bladed weapon by someone he knew.

According to the initial press release, officers were dispatched at about 7:40pm and rendered first aid to the injured man before he was transported to the hospital with “serious by non-life-threatening injuries” and later released.

The suspect reportedly fled the scene before police arrived, but officers recovered a weapon they believed was used in the assault.
